Son of James Thomas Madderra and Nancy Ann Lawless Madderra. Served as a Private, Co G, 49th Ala Inf, in the Civil War. His Civil War records state in served as a Musician.

Children of James Tanner Madderra and Annie Scott Madderra:

William L. Madderra
Thomas N. Madderra
Frances E. Madderra Collins
James Hamilton Madderra
Nancy Ann Madderra Beck
John B. Madderra
Rosie L. Madderra Jackson
